tsarisme
tsaʁism
Definition
Definition of tsarisme - Reverso French Dictionary
Noun, masculine
régime politiqueDated système politique où le tsar exerce un pouvoir absoluDated
- Le tsarisme a dominé la Russie pendant plusieurs siècles.
- Le tsarisme a été aboli après la révolution de 1917.
- Certains historiens analysent les conséquences du tsarisme sur la société russe.
Origin of tsarisme
russe, tsar (titre impérial) + -isme (suffixe idéologique)
